Manage Any Pain As Best You Can
Finally, if you are finding that you have to go through everyday pain then there will be some ways to manage this. You could visit your doctor to find out how they can help you, it might be natural remedies or strong painkillers. If your aches and pains have been caused by an injury then you could look into physio to rid yourself of the pain. Alternatively, surgery might also be an option if you are a suitable candidate.
You don’t have to live your life in pain, all day every day, that just wouldn’t be fair. Although there are some health conditions where it just isn’t possible for your pain to go away. Chronic pain can be hard to live with, while nerve pain can really end up getting on your last nerve! Explore all your options before you give up hope, you never know what new treatments will come out when you least expect it.
